Intro to Static Bike Exercise
A static bike, likewise called a stationary bicycle, imitates the experience of riding a bicycle without the need for outdoor area or weather considerations. These bikes can be found in numerous forms, consisting of upright, recumbent, and spin bikes, each designed to accommodate various physical fitness needs and preferences. Static bike exercises are particularly useful for people of all ages and physical fitness levels, as they offer a controlled environment to boost endurance, burn calories, and improve overall health.

Key Benefits of Static Bike Exercise
Improved Cardiovascular Health

Enhanced Endurance: Regular static bike exercise strengthens the heart and lungs, improving your cardiovascular endurance. This can cause better efficiency in other exercises and a lowered threat of heart illness.
Lower Blood Pressure: Cycling can help lower high blood pressure, lowering the pressure on your heart and enhancing blood flow throughout the body.
Increased HDL Cholesterol: Cycling has actually been shown to increase levels of high-density lipoprotein (HDL) cholesterol, often described as "good" cholesterol, which assists get rid of harmful cholesterol from the bloodstream.
Weight Management

Calorie Burning: Static bike exercise is an effective way to burn calories. Depending on the strength and period of your exercise, you can burn anywhere from 400 to 1000 calories per hour.
Fat Loss: Consistent biking can help reduce body fat, especially in the lower body, and enhance muscle tone.
Metabolic Boost: Regular exercise can enhance your metabolism, making it easier to keep a healthy weight in time.
Muscle Strength and Tone

Leg Muscles: Cycling mostly targets the quadriceps, hamstrings, calves, and glutes, helping to construct and tone these muscles.
Core Stability: While primarily a leg exercise, static biking likewise engages the core muscles, enhancing stability and balance.
Low Impact: Unlike running or leaping, static bike exercise is low-impact, making it appropriate for people with joint concerns or injuries.
Mental Health Benefits

Tension Reduction: Exercise, including biking, launches endorphins, which are natural state of mind lifters. This can help in reducing tension and stress and anxiety.
Improved Cognitive Function: Regular exercise, such as cycling, has actually been linked to enhanced cognitive function and a reduced danger of age-related psychological decline.
Improved Sleep: Exercise can assist control your sleep patterns, leading to better quality sleep.
Strategies to Maximize Your Static Bike Workout
Warm-Up and Cool-Down

Warm-Up: Start with a 5-10 minute mild ride to warm up your muscles and increase blood circulation. You can also include dynamic stretches like leg swings and arm circles.
Cool-Down: End your workout with a 5-10 minute sluggish ride to cool off and avoid muscle stiffness. Static stretches focusing on the legs, back, and arms can also be helpful.
Differed Intensity Workouts

Period Training: Incorporate high-intensity periods (HIIT) into your regimen. For example, cycle at a high resistance for 30 seconds, followed by a 1-2 minute recovery period at a lower resistance. Repeat this cycle 5-10 times.
Endurance Training: For longer, steady-state trips, aim to preserve a constant moderate intensity. This is excellent for constructing endurance and can be combined with light resistance to challenge your muscles.
Hill Training: Use the resistance settings to replicate hills. This can include range to your workout and aid develop strength.
Appropriate Form and Posture

Change the Bike: Ensure the seat and handlebars are gotten used to the right height and range. The seat should be level and permit for a slight bend in your knee when the pedal is at its floor.

Foot Placement: Place your feet on the pedals so that the ball of your foot is centered over the pedal axle. This ensures optimum power transfer and reduces the danger of injury.
Hydration and Nutrition


Stay Hydrated: Drink water before, throughout, and after your workout to stay hydrated. Dehydration can impair your performance and recovery.
Fuel Your Body: Consume a balanced meal or snack consisting of carbs and protein about 1-2 hours before your exercise. This will offer the energy you require and assist with muscle healing.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s).
Is static bike exercise as effective as outside biking?

While both deal outstanding cardiovascular benefits, static bike exercise can be just as effective as outdoor cycling, particularly for beginners and those with movement problems. Static bikes offer a regulated environment, allowing for consistent resistance and intensity, which can be beneficial for targeted training.
How often should I use a static bike?

For basic health and physical fitness, aim to utilize a static bike 3-4 times a week for 30-60 minutes per session. Nevertheless, the frequency and period can differ based on your physical fitness goals and present level of activity.
Can static bike exercise assist with pain in the back?

Yes, static bike exercise can be beneficial for people with back discomfort. The low-impact nature of cycling reduces strain on the spine, and the core engagement during the ride can help reinforce back muscles, offering assistance and decreasing discomfort.
What are the very best static bike exercises for weight loss?

Mix exercises that include period training, hill simulations, and steady-state trips are perfect for weight-loss. These methods help burn more calories and enhance metabolic rate with time.
How do I avoid knee discomfort while cycling?

Proper bike setup and kind are essential for preventing knee discomfort. Guarantee the seat height is correct and maintain a small bend in your knee at the bottom of the pedal stroke. If you experience discomfort, seek advice from a physical fitness expert or doctor.
Can I use a static bike for rehabilitation?
